Output 75c7fa4878b9e8145dbc9248c6563ab3a6ca578b33fa7c6c0b29fd1a80409d7e:0

value
28000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d072fa90f6ae43197b5ab174ce6354cbc68905 OP_EQUAL
address
34mowB3g1x9xyTQ5Yz5Hqt85JXkF6U87w3
transaction
75c7fa4878b9e8145dbc9248c6563ab3a6ca578b33fa7c6c0b29fd1a80409d7e
spent
true